Redoubtable (Adjective)
Sentence with Context:
One of English cricket’s most redoubtable cottage industries has reached the end of its story with the publication of what has been presented as “the 42nd and last volume from Fairfield Books” – the small-scale publishing company that dared to chronicle some of cricket’s lesser-known stories and somehow survived to tell the tale.
Source: www.espncricinfo.com
Meaning: Formidable (especially as an opponent)
Synonyms
Formidable, Impressive, Daunting, Indomitable, Invincible, Doughty
Antonyms
Average, Unimpressive, Mediocre, Insignificant
Mnemonic (Memory Aid): How To Remember?
Imagine a strong and persistent wrestler who does not give up. In a tough fight, it may seem that he/ she may give up but you have to think twice before doubting that because he/ she is formidable and resilient and does not easily give up. Remember “Re-doubt-able” thus!
